moreutils projektet är en växande samling av Unix verktyg som ingen trodde att skriva trettio år sedan.
Det includs verktyg för att få nätverksinformation för att markera standard in med tidsstämplar, för att kontrollera om en dataström är UTF-8, för att kombinera de linjer i två filer med booleska operationer, för att suga upp standard input och skriva till en fil, att redigera en katalog i din textredigerare för att infoga en textredigerare i ett rör, och tee standard in till rören.
Förmodligen den mest allmänt ändamål verktyg moreutils hittills är svamp (1), som låter dig göra saker så här:
% Sed "s / root / toor /" / etc / passwd | grep -v joey | svamp / etc / passwd
Det finns mycket mer som anges i README, och jag är alltid intresserad av att lägga mer till samlingen, så länge de är lämpligt för allmänt ändamål.
Verktyg som övervägs
Här är några som är under övervägande, men har ännu inte tagits, jag välkomnar också synpunkter om vilket av dessa ska ingå.
mime
bestämmer mime typ av fil med gnome gruvan databasen
(Mer användbar än fil (1) i många fall men skulle lägga en hel del gnome bibliotek för paketets beroendekedja.)
z
gör ett annat program förstå komprimerade filer
ex: z zxgv file.bmp.gz
(Vågar jag ta "z" namn?)
TMP
sätter stdin i en temp-fil och skickar den till den angivna programmet
ex: zcat file.bmp.gz | tmp zxgv
lägga till
lägger upp nummer från stdin
todist
ingångar en lista med tal och matar deras fördelning, ett värde och hur många gånger det förekommer i inmatnings http://baruch.ev-en.org/files/todist
(Inte en allmän nog unix verktyg, förmodligen?)
tostats
ingångar en lista med tal och utgångar statistik om antalet: genomsnitt, STD, min, max, mittpunkten http://baruch.ev-en.org/files/tostats
Mjukvaruinformation:
Version: 0.7
Ladda upp dagen: 3 Jun 15
Licens: Gratis
Popularitet: 26
Kommentarer hittades inte